在这个数字化时代,编程已经成为一种基础技能。让孩子从小就接触编程,不仅能够培养他们的逻辑思维能力,还能激发他们的创造力和解决问题的能力。那么,如何让少儿编程变得既有趣又容易上手呢?以下将为你揭秘少儿智趣编程的奥秘与入门技巧。
基础理念:寓教于乐,激发兴趣
1. 游戏化学习
编程对于孩子来说,可以像玩游戏一样充满乐趣。通过设计有趣的游戏和互动式项目,让孩子们在游戏中学习编程概念。
2. 故事化教学
将编程知识融入有趣的故事中,让孩子们在听故事的过程中,不知不觉地学习到编程的原理。
选择合适的编程语言和工具
1. scratch
Scratch是一款非常适合初学者的编程工具,它通过积木式的编程界面,让孩子们可以直观地理解编程逻辑。
# Scratch 示例代码
when Green Flag clicked
repeat 10
move 10 steps
turn right 90
2. blockly
Blockly是一款由Google开发的图形化编程工具,支持多种编程语言,如JavaScript和Python。
// Blockly 示例代码
function drawCircle() {
context.beginPath();
context.arc(100, 100, 50, 0, 2 * Math.PI);
context.stroke();
}
drawCircle();
实践操作:动手实践是关键
1. 项目驱动
通过实际项目来引导孩子学习编程,比如制作一个简单的游戏、设计一个互动式的动画等。
2. 小步快跑
在学习过程中,不要急于求成,而是应该从小项目开始,逐步提高难度。
家庭支持:陪伴与鼓励
1. 家长参与
家长可以参与到孩子的编程学习中,了解他们的学习进度,并给予适当的鼓励和支持。
2. 营造良好的学习氛围
在家中创造一个有利于学习的环境,比如为孩子准备一个专门的编程工作台,提供必要的工具和书籍。
结语
少儿编程不仅仅是一种技能的培养,更是一种思维的锻炼。通过有趣的学习方式和适当的家庭支持,孩子们可以轻松地走进编程的世界,发现其中的乐趣。记住,编程是一种语言,它教会我们的不仅仅是如何写代码,更是如何用代码来表达自己的想法。让我们一起,开启孩子的编程之旅吧!
